Key Responsibilities:
-
Load, unload, move, and stage raw materials, components, and finished products throughout the facility.
-
Operate material handling equipment such as forklifts, pallet jacks, and hand trucks (training or certification provided as needed).
-
Ensure materials are delivered to production lines accurately and on time to support efficient operations.
-
Perform inventory transactions, including receiving, labeling, and tracking materials to maintain accurate inventory records.
-
Conduct visual inspections of materials and report any damage, discrepancies, or quality concerns.
-
Maintain organized storage areas and ensure proper material placement according to company standards.
-
Follow all safety procedures and maintain a clean, organized work environment in compliance with company and OSHA guidelines.
-
Collaborate with production, shipping, and receiving teams to meet daily operational goals.
-
Accurately document material movements and complete required paperwork or system entries.
-
Promptly report equipment issues, inventory shortages, or safety hazards to supervisors.
